Klappentext
A controversial investigation into geoengineering, surveillance technology, and the militarization of the atmosphere.
Chemtrails, HAARP, and the Full Spectrum Dominance of Planet Earth by Elana M. Freeland examines claims and theories surrounding atmospheric experimentation, military research, and emerging global communications technologies. Situating itself within the literature of alternative science and geopolitical speculation, the book explores how weather modification research, aerospace development, and satellite infrastructure have been interpreted by critics as components of a broader technological transformation of the planet.
Freeland analyzes public documents, patents, and media reports to construct a narrative connecting geoengineering debates, high-frequency research installations, and evolving military doctrine. The book also considers the cultural and political context in which discussions of surveillance, environmental intervention, and advanced communications systems have gained attention. Rather than presenting a conventional scientific overview, it engages with the discourse surrounding contested interpretations of atmospheric technology and global infrastructure.
Widely discussed among readers of alternative research, conspiracy studies, and speculative geopolitics, the book has become a touchstone within communities examining the intersection of environmental technology, government secrecy, and technological change. It is frequently read alongside other works addressing geoengineering, surveillance culture, and twenty-first-century military strategy.
